Publisher's description of DocScan
DocScan software drives your document scanner, reads the barcode on the first page of your documents, and then organizes the scanned pages into multi-page TIFF & PDF files. It can scan color, merge, and split scanned images, OCR your scanned document and produce a searchable PDF. DocScan is a .NET application and you can even use it with any records or document management (EDRM) product. DocScan works with any TWAIN scanner; supports high speed document feeding & multi-page TIFF files; automatically recognizes a barcode on the first page of any multi-page document; scans & stores it as a TIFF file using the barcode number as the filename; allows you to manipulate TIFF images by inserting or appending pages; handles monochrome & color images; automates the bulk scanning process.
